Another "whats this wire for??" question. Alternator wire..

okay so heres my problem, i switched over to carb and and this wire connects to the alternator by a bolt, and runs with the same harness as the starter/battery wires. does this wire connect to the starter, or does it connect to that black box that the battery connects to behine the passenger side headlight? or is it a ground... what the hell is it!! i been thinkin all day about how my alternator is going to charge the battery and i thought maybe this wire charged it? but it looks like a ground, yet it has the same gauge of wire that starters have.. anybody can help me?? heres a picture of the full wire.

thats the charging wire charges the batt the plug is sumthin els (idk disconected it voltage droped so put bak in) but the wire with the bolt is the charging wire . btw frome the looks of it i recomend upgrade..... actualy i did a big 4 upgrade.... yes 4 alt-->bat-->starter(powers evrything) and bat-->chassi-->engine blok also can add bat to engine block but not realy necessary hope this helps
